Deana Butler, 1879
Deana Butler, 1879; Ann. Mag. Nat. Hist. (5) 4 (24): 451, TS: Adena xanthialis Walker
= Adena ; Hampson, 1899, Proc. Zool. Soc. London 1899 : 226
Adena Walker, 1863; List Spec. Lepid. Insects Colln Br. Mus. 27: 197, TS: Adena xanthialis Walker
= ; [GlobIZ]
Nesarcha Meyrick, 1884; Trans. Ent. Soc. Lond. 1884 (3): 330, TS: Scopula hybreasalis Walker
= Adena ; Hampson, 1899, Proc. Zool. Soc. London 1899 : 226
= ; [GlobIZ]
Adena (Pyraustinae) ; Hampson, 1899, Proc. Zool. Soc. London 1899 : 226
Deana (Spilomelinae) ; [GlobIZ]

Deana hybreasalis (Walker, 1859)
New Zealand Scopula hybreasalis Walker, 1859; List Spec. Lepid. Insects Colln Br. Mus. 18: 797
Scopula pareonalis Walker, 1859; List Spec. Lepid. Insects Colln Br. Mus. 18: 797
Adena xanthialis Walker, 1863; List Spec. Lepid. Insects Colln Br. Mus. 27: 198
